Price

Second-hand  mobility scooters  are usually less expensive than new models. It's a great option to save money, but you also have the chance of buying a scooter that breaks down or has other problems. If you're worried about this, it is best to buy from a licensed dealer who has checked the scooter over thoroughly prior to putting it up for sale.

A used scooter can be a great opportunity to give a vehicle that is in excellent condition a second chance at. This will stop it from being discarded. However, this isn't always the case and it's worth exploring all possibilities available to you, and determining if any the major components such as batteries or tyres are wearing out before making a purchase.

You should also ask the seller any questions you have about the scooter, especially when they are selling it through a shop or private seller. For instance, you should be able to discover how much the scooter was used, what it was used for, and whether it was regularly serviced and maintained. Ask if it comes with any additional features, as this can make the scooter more expensive than a new one.

If a vehicle isn't worth the price then it's likely the owner hasn't taken good care of it. It will break down sooner or later. You should be prepared to spend some extra money to ensure that the scooter you purchase is in good shape and offers smooth riding.

The Right to Rent

If you are purchasing a second-hand mobility scooter, it is crucial to find out whether the seller has a warranty. This is particularly important when purchasing from an individual seller or classifieds site, as these types of purchases typically don't offer any type of warranty. This is why it's recommended to buy from a licensed seller since they are likely to have more stringent checks in place and be able to offer an assurance.

If you talk to a seller, ask them about the age of the scooter as as the history of its use. This will help you determine if the scooter is suitable for your requirements. It is also important to know what sort of maintenance has been performed on the scooter, if there was any. This will help you determine whether the scooter has been maintained and is safe to use.

Last but not least, make sure you check the condition and size of the scooter's battery. These are expensive parts to replace, so it is important to ensure that the batteries and tires on the scooter are in good working condition. You can ask the seller to test the battery for you or test it yourself before you make a purchase decision.

Finally, you should ask whether there are spare parts for the scooter. This is crucial, particularly in the case of a scooter that is more sophisticated and might require specific parts to maintain it or repair it. Request the seller's maintenance records or manuals on the scooter to determine the cost.

Safety

If you're looking to buy a used mobility device, it's important to check that the battery and tyres are in good condition. If they're not, you may be required to pay more money in the future to replace them. Check the service history. The majority of people will be able to provide you with the information but if you're not able get all the information they can provide and you are not able to, it should trigger some alarms.
